#1f02c9 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1f02c9 is composed of 12.2% red, 0.8% green and 78.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.6% cyan, 99% magenta, 0% yellow and 21.2% black. It has a hue angle of 248.7 degrees, a saturation of 98% and a lightness of 39.8%. #1f02c9 color hex could be obtained by blending #3e04ff with #000093.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

#1f02c9 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1f02c9 has RGB values of R:31, G:2, B:201 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0.99, Y:0, K:0.21. Its decimal value is 2032329.

Shades and Tints of #1f02c9
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010007 is the darkest color, while #f4f2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1f02c9
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#61606b is the less saturated color, while #1f02c9 is the most saturated one.
